About Libby and Ness
Ness and Libby are sisters, they've spent their whole life together and we would love to keep them together for the rest of their lives. They have spent the first part of their lives in a research facility and are now ready to find a foster family!
Ness is super sweet, gentle and very chilled out. She loves a cuddle and scratch! Libby is very much the same! She's a little more cheeky than her sister Ness, but equally as loveable.
Both girls are loving, smoochy and inquisitive. They love to lounge around, sun bake, and want to be included in all the family activities. They have not lived in a house before so we are looking for a foster home to get them used to the signs and sounds that we all take for granted.
Both girls need some follow up vet checks needed and Ness has a potential ACL tear which needs further investigation. So it's important that their new foster family is able to travel to our vet in Caulfield or our specialist vet in Collingwood.
The girls don't need a huge yard to play in, just somewhere to toilet and lounge in the sun or shade. They do need secure fencing and must only be walked on lead. They are great with other dogs, they have never lived with cats before but have so far shown no interest in them. They're great with bigger kids and humans of all kinds - if you have cuddles to give, then these 2 will love you unconditionally!
